ZIP Code 30575 — Talmo, GA

Jackson | 2024 Census Data

Key Takeaway

ZIP code 30575 in Talmo, GA has a population of 1,589 with a median household income of $84,750 and a median home value of $269,600 . The cost of living index is 97.8 (national average = 100).
